The Art of Being a Person is a one stop workshop practical life skills and community-building course designed to help young people confidently transition into adulthood.
Combining creative learning, civic engagement, communication skills, and real-world guidance, the course equips participants with foundational tools often missing from traditional education.
Inspired by How to Be a Person, the class uses art, storytelling, roleplay, discussion, and guest experts to make adulthood feel less intimidating and more human.
Sessions emphasize empathy, confidence, accountability, and practical independence.
Participants will leave with:
-A starter resume and job application experience
-Basic financial literacy knowledge
-Communication and conflict-resolution tools
-Civic engagement understanding
-Household management skills
-Internet and digital safety awareness
-Confidence navigating adulthood independently
Audience: Ages 16-24
